18 Best Things to Do in Dubai This Weekend (27–29 June): Brunches, Football, Staycations and More

Live shows and wellness experiences

A live journey through sound with Imelda Gabs

Where: Theatre of Digital Art, Souk Madinat Jumeirah
When: 27 June

This performance blends live piano, vocals, and electronic soundscapes into a continuously evolving musical experience. Rather than a traditional concert format, the show is built around real-time creation, where layers of sound are formed and transformed in front of the audience. The result is a cinematic atmosphere that shifts between soulful, ambient, and experimental tones. Set inside the Theatre of Digital Art, the experience is further amplified by visual projections that respond to the music, making it feel more like stepping inside a living composition than attending a performance.

Prana Harmony – Breathwork and Live Music Journey

Where: Theatre of Digital Art, Souk Madinat Jumeirah
When: 29 June
Price: Ticketed (varies)

If you really seek a reset this weekend, we know where to send you. Prana Harmony promises a restorative wellness session that combines guided breathwork, meditation techniques, and live multi-instrumental music. The experience focuses on regulating breath and energy through structured cycles of inhalation, retention, and release, supported by calming sound layers performed live. It is created for those who want to reset, and move away from overstimulation and into a more grounded state. The setting, paired with the immersive audio environment, creates a slow-paced, reflective space intended to leave guests feeling balanced and re-energised.

Family Fun Day – Walk to Unlock Challenge

Where: Ibn Battuta Mall
When: 28 June
Price: Free (requires FITZE app)

Ibn Battuta Mall transforms into a wellness-focused activity space through its “Walk to Unlock” campaign, encouraging visitors to complete a 12,000-step challenge across its themed courts.

Participants can track their steps using the FITZE app while exploring the mall’s architectural zones, each inspired by different regions of the world. Rewards are unlocked at milestone points, including 6,000, 8,000, and 12,000 steps, with participating retailers offering exclusive deals and discounts. The concept mixes light fitness activity with retail engagement, making it a structured yet flexible way to stay active indoors during the summer weekend.

Game nights, screenings and food offers

Al Abdalla – Boxpark

Where: Boxpark
Price: Dh52 solo meal; group deals from AED 111

Al Abdalla offers a casual, value-driven match-night experience with a focus on hearty comfort food. The solo meal includes a large charcoal chicken sandwich paired with sides, while group bundles add shared plates such as kaake bites, sandwiches, sides, and drinks. The setting is designed for informal gatherings, making it suitable for friends watching matches together without the formality of a sports bar. Its location within Boxpark also adds to the urban, laid-back atmosphere, appealing to those who prefer a simple food-forward viewing experience.

Weekend brunches and dining deals

Alici

Where: Bluewaters
When: Saturday and Sunday, 1:00 pm – 4:00 pm
Price: From Dh315

Alici’s weekend brunch at Bluewaters is a laid-back South Italian affair that embraces fresh seafood and seasonal flavours. A relaxed coastal dining with prepared dishes that are intended to just let you unwind.

Families are well taken care of too, with kids dining for free, making it an easy win for group outings. Adults can also enjoy discounted beverage packages, adding a little extra indulgence without stretching the budget. The whole experience is designed to slow things down, encouraging guests to linger over the table, enjoy the view, and stretch the brunch into a leisurely afternoon.

The Spaniel – Steak Frites Friday

Where: Bluewaters
When: Every Friday, from 5:00 pm
Price: From Dh130

This weekly special keeps things refreshingly simple, focusing on a classic steak-and-fries pairing done right. Expect a well-prepared premium cut served with crisp, golden fries and familiar sides that let the quality of the ingredients do most of the talking.

It’s not about theatrics or overcomplication, just a solid, satisfying plate in a relaxed, casual setting. It’s the kind of meal that appeals to anyone who appreciates good steak without the fuss, served consistently week after week.

Staycations and resort offers

Centara Mirage Beach Resort Dubai – UAE Residents Offer

When: Book by 30 June | Stay until 30 June

This limited-time staycation is an easy, feel-good escape for UAE residents, built around simple perks that make a short break feel more special. Along with discounted room rates, guests get savings across dining, drinks, and spa treatments, plus the everyday comforts that matter most, complimentary breakfast and flexible check-in or check-out, depending on availability.

It’s also designed with downtime in mind. Guests get full access to the resort’s waterpark, private beach, and kids’ club, making it a relaxed option for families who want everything in one place without overplanning. For those booking select room categories, access to the Mirage Family Lounge adds an extra layer of comfort, turning the stay into something closer to a mini holiday than just a weekend away.

Al Habtoor Polo Resort – Fan Zone and weekend Dining

The resort hosts a dedicated fan zone with live screenings and match-day dining packages. The Football Fan Zone combo includes a burger, fries, popcorn, and drinks at an accessible price point, while weekend roasts offer a more traditional dining experience featuring beef or lamb served with sides. The setup blends sporting entertainment with a resort-style leisure environment.

Dining experiences

Amelia – First Flight Experience

Where: Address Sky View
Price: Dh225 per person

First Flight is a curated multi-course dining experience that takes guests through Amelia’s signature Japanese-Peruvian menu with Mediterranean influences. Designed as a structured culinary journey, it features a progression of small plates, mains, and desserts, each crafted for sharing and storytelling. The experience takes place in a visually striking, retro-futuristic interior with panoramic city views, making it both a dining and atmospheric experience.

Zenon – Mythos Twilight Dining

Where: Kempinski Central Avenue, Downtown Dubai
Price: Dh245 per person

Mythos Twilight Dining is a sunset-inspired Mediterranean dining concept that has a three-course menu. Guests choose from starters such as scallops or tempura, mains including seabass or braised beef cheeks, and desserts like chocolate fondant or cheesecake. The experience is designed around the golden-hour transition into evening, combining refined cuisine with a modern, tech-driven dining environment in Downtown Dubai.
